Frequently Asked Questions
What are the typical vaccination requirements for dog daycare in Parrott?
Most reputable daycares in and around Parrott require proof of up-to-date vaccinations from a licensed veterinarian. This typically includes Rabies, DHPP (Distemper, Hepatitis, Parainfluenza, Parvovirus), and Bordetella (kennel cough). Some facilities may also require a negative fecal test. Due to the rural nature of Pulaski County, ensuring all pets are protected against common parasites like ticks and fleas is also highly recommended.
How much does dog daycare typically cost in Parrott, Virginia?
For a full day of daycare in the Parrott area, you can expect to pay between $20 and $30. Many local facilities offer discounted multi-day packages, such as a 5-day pass for $90-$110. Pricing can vary based on the facility's amenities, like indoor/outdoor play areas or webcam access. Overnight boarding is a separate service and usually costs more.
What should I bring for my pet's first day of daycare?
For a smooth first day, bring your dog on a secure leash and collar with ID tags. You should also provide your pet's vaccination records if not already submitted. While many daycares provide bowls and toys, it's a good idea to bring your dog's regular food for meals and any necessary medications with clear instructions. Given our proximity to the New River, if your dog has been swimming recently, ensure they are clean and dry to prevent any skin issues.

What kind of activities and socialization can my dog expect?
A quality Parrott daycare will provide structured playgroups based on size and temperament. Activities often include supervised group play, individual attention, and rest periods. Some may offer enrichment like puzzle toys or agility equipment. Be sure to ask about their staff-to-dog ratio and how they manage different play styles to ensure a safe and positive experience for your pet throughout the day.
